Polar Instruments Si9000 is one of the most important tools for anyone working on high speed digital designs. The software is aimed at estimating trace impedance and can help simulate loss less trace impedance as well as analyse how trace impedance would change based on the frequency of interest. There are a number of built in PCB layer stack-up configurations available within the tool and all the user needs to do is to enter relevant data for a chosen stack-up and click the calculate button. The calculated database can be saved and retrieved at a later time, making it non-repetitive.
